Friends of the Clearwater and the Palouse Group of the Sierra Club are hosting an overnight camping and hiking trip into the upper Weitas Creek basin. Depending on snow conditions in the area, possible alternate routes may include the Gravey Creek and the Cayuse Creek watersheds. These and adjacent drainages together constitute the 255,000-acre Weitas Creek Roadless Area – the largest, unprotected wildland not adjoining designated wilderness in the Clearwater and Nez Perce National Forests.
